Build Plugin
Bundle many tools (skills, hooks, agents, MCP servers) into one installable Claude Code plugin and distribute it. The defining move of this skill: establish who the plugin is for and where it will live with AskUserQuestion before assembling anything, then tailor every phase to that answer. A personal one-project bundle and a public team marketplace share almost nothing past "assemble", so branch early and commit to the branch.
How this relates to build-mcp
build-mcp builds one MCP server: analyze a service, implement the tools, deploy, scale. build-plugin bundles many tools (including MCP servers produced by build-mcp) into a single shareable unit and distributes it. When build-mcp reaches its Distribute phase for a team or public audience, it hands off here: packaging into a plugin and listing it on a marketplace is this skill's job. Use build-mcp to make a server, then build-plugin to ship it alongside your skills, hooks, and agents.
The four phases
- Analyze: decide what tools go in the bundle, and name it.
- Assemble: build the plugin folder and manifest, test it locally with
claude --plugin-dir.
- Ship: put it on a marketplace repo, on the right git host, public or private, with one-click enablement for a team.
- Maintain: versions, updates, ownership, and admin controls.
Run them in order. The AskUserQuestion answers from Phase 0 gate Ship and Maintain.

Phase 1: Analyze
Decide what goes in the bundle before you build the folder.
- Inventory the tools. List every skill, hook, agent, and MCP server the plugin should carry. A plugin can hold any mix; each type sits in its own place in the layout (see assemble.md).
- Draw the boundary. One plugin is one coherent unit that updates together. If two groups of tools serve different audiences or version on different clocks, that is two plugins.
- Name it. Kebab-case, distinct, describes the bundle not one tool inside it. The name becomes the skill namespace (
/my-plugin:skill) and the marketplace entry key.
- Note what already exists loose. Tools sitting in
~/.claude/skills, ~/.claude/agents, or a personal settings.json will move into the plugin and the loose originals get deleted, so you do not run duplicates (assemble.md covers this).
Deliverable: the plugin name plus a list of what it will contain. Confirm with the user before assembling.
Phase 2: Assemble
Read references/assemble.md. Build the folder to the layout, write the manifest, then test locally.
- Create the plugin dir. Only
plugin.json goes inside .claude-plugin/; skills/, agents/, hooks/hooks.json, and .mcp.json sit at the plugin ROOT.
- Write
.claude-plugin/plugin.json with name, description, version, author.
- Move the inventoried tools in and delete the loose originals.
- Validate, then load-test.
claude plugin validate . checks the manifest and layout with no login. claude plugin details <name> lists the skills, hooks, and servers it discovered, also login-free. claude --plugin-dir ./my-plugin (it also accepts a .zip) loads it into a live session so you can invoke a tool; that one needs you logged in.
For a "Just me" bundle this is the last substantive phase: it is loaded, it works, stop.
Phase 3: Ship
Only for team or public. Read references/marketplace.md, and references/team-enablement.md for the auto-enable path. Branch on the git-host answer.
- Create the marketplace repo, or reuse an existing one. Add
.claude-plugin/marketplace.json at its root with name, owner, and a plugins[] entry for this plugin.
- Set the entry
source by host: relative "./path" if the plugin lives in the same repo, {source:"github", repo:"owner/repo"} for GitHub, or {source:"url", url:"https://...git"} for GitLab, Bitbucket, or self-hosted. There is no gitlab source type.
- Choose public vs private to match the audience. A private repo keeps a team plugin internal; a public repo is installable by anyone who knows it, running arbitrary code with the user's privileges, so make that choice deliberately.
- Confirm the install path a colleague runs:
/plugin marketplace add owner/repo (GitHub shorthand) or the full https://...git URL for any other host, then /plugin install name@marketplace.
Phase 4: Maintain
Read references/maintain.md. Branch lightly; the mechanics are the same across hosts.
- Updates. Users pull new versions with
/plugin marketplace update or at startup.
- Version boundary. Bump
version in plugin.json so users get a clean update boundary; omit it and Claude Code treats every commit SHA as a new version.
- Ownership. One maintainer per plugin. Fixes land via merge request, since the source is a git repo.
- Org controls (team/public, admin job). Force-install, an allowlist (
strictKnownMarketplaces), or a denylist (blockedMarketplaces) live in a managed-settings file, set by an admin, not per user (team-enablement.md).
Done criteria
- The plugin validates (
claude plugin validate) and its tools show up (claude plugin details); loading it via claude --plugin-dir in a session invokes at least one.
- It is on a marketplace repo the resolved audience can reach, public or private matching that audience (or, for "Just me", it is loaded locally and there is no marketplace).
- The user can name exactly how a colleague installs it, two-command or one-click, matching the audience answer.
